Most walkers will be aware of the need to let someone know where they are walking. Even if you are not staying with us, by all means drop in and let us know that you are walking in the area and complete one of our forms.
We often have a visit from the police asking if we know who a particular car belongs to - almost always it is someone who is camping out in the hills or staying in a mountain bothy, but if we know this, it saves the police and rescue services wasting time.
If you let us know the route you are taking, where you are parking (and a description of your car), when you are due back and at what time to contact the emergency services, it helps us to raise the alarm if necessary and as soon as possible.
